# Word generator (for all you goddam keeb nerds 🤓)

## The story

I was using this funny site to learn Colemak DHm and slowly started realising that the site was (and still is) nowhere near as funny as I thought and came to the conclusion that Monkeytype is signifficantly more funny. Here's the problem: the site was able to generate to generate different level words, such as only using finger keys, or adding adjacent keys to the mix (so like only using `arst` `neio` for example), but Monkeytype has no such feature.

yeah anw this exists now, use it with custom mode in Monkeytype and you can get the ultimate training experience

## Project versioning

`year.breaking.minor`

- `year` of release
- goes up in case there's a `breaking` change
- `minor` goes up with each update
